Gitea (Git with a cup of tea) is a painless self-hosted Git service written in Go

GitLab is described as 'Offers on-premise or hosted Git repository management, including issue tracking, wikis, code reviews, and continuous integration and deployment' and is a leading Version Control system in the development category. There are more than 100 alternatives to GitLab for a variety of platforms, including Web-based, Self-Hosted, Linux, Mac and Windows apps. The best GitLab alternative is GitHub, which is free. Other great apps like GitLab are Gitea, Gogs, Codeberg and Bitbucket.
Gitea (Git with a cup of tea) is a painless self-hosted Git service written in Go

Cloud Source Repositories helps you privately host, track, and manage changes to large codebases on Google Cloud Platform.



Azure DevOps Server is a set of collaborative software development tools for the entire team, hosted on-premises. Azure DevOps Server integrates with your existing IDE or editor to help your cross-functional team work effectively on projects of all sizes.
Tangled is a new social-enabled Git collaboration platform, built on top of the AT Protocol. We envision a place where developers have complete ownership of their code, open source communities can freely self-govern and most importantly, coding can be social and fun again.




Space is an integrated team environment that provides a toolset combining instant communication, team and project management, collaboration, and software development processes into a single solution.




Gerrit simplifies Git based project maintainership by permitting any authorized user to submit changes to the master Git repository, rather than requiring all approved changes to be merged in by hand by the project maintainer.


Set up your own self hosted git server on IIS for Windows. Manage users and have full control over your repositories with a nice user friendly graphical interface.




Host open-source software projects using Subversion or Mercurial for revision control. Google Code also includes a wiki for documentation, issue tracking and file download feature. It is free for Open Source projects that are licensed under one of nine licenses (Apache...

Super Easy All-In-One DevOps Platform. Contribute to theonedev/onedev development by creating an account on GitHub.




Hosted Gitea is a private, fully managed alternative to GitHub and Gitlab. We deploy a fully provisioned Gitea instance and manage it for you. We take care of updates, security, backups, OS upgrades, and monitoring so you can focus on writing and comiting code.


It is just a good, easy to use and set up Git Server Server for windows (IIS). I recommend it for every Windows environment that just needs a git server.